Romanian tennis player Ana Bogdan qualified on Tuesday for the second round of the WTA 125 tournament in Marbella, with total prizes of 92,742 dollars, by defeating the Croatian Donna Vekic, 6-1, 6-0.
Bogdan (29, the 95th in the WTA) needed just 55 minutes to get past Vekic (25, the 110th in the WTA).
Bogdan secured a cheque for 1,936 euros and 15 WTA points, and in the next round she will face Slovakia's Anna Karolina Schmiedlova, the 8th seed, who defeated Serbian Aleksandra Krunic 6-2, 6-4.
Schmiedlova (27 years old, the 92nd WTA) won both direct matches with Ana, in 2018, in the semifinals in Bogota, 6-3, 6-2, and in the first round in Bucharest, 4-6, 7-6 (4 ), 7-5.
